Analysis
The most recent figure for heating degree days, gaps filled in Hungary is 4,468, measured in 2024.
That represents a change of up 0.7% on the previous year and up 2.0% over ten years.
Over the whole period, heating degree days, gaps filled in Hungary peaked at 6,241 in 1980 and was at its lowest, 4,379, in 2014.
Hungary ranks 50th of 189 countries on this measure, in the middle of the range.
The long-run direction has been consistently falling across the 65 years of available data.

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1960s | 5,570 | 4,894 | 6,088 | 10 |
| 1970s | 5,535 | 5,172 | 5,904 | 10 |
| 1980s | 5,690 | 5,146 | 6,241 | 10 |
| 1990s | 5,523 | 4,963 | 6,098 | 10 |
| 2000s | 5,229 | 4,807 | 5,794 | 10 |
| 2010s | 5,006 | 4,379 | 5,589 | 10 |
| 2020s | 4,771 | 4,437 | 5,316 | 5 |

How this figure is calculated
Heating Degree Days with 237 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
Computed from
- Heating Degree Days World Bank, Climate Change Knowledge Portal. https://climateknowledgeportal.worldbank.org
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
